1201m is great, one of the best blanks around. The butt of that rod has plenty power. Keep in mind that many giant fish are hooked within 50' of the rocks there. Learn to fish the shelfs there right on the bank. Short cast with an eel, let it sink, and swing it. Night time is always good, the breaking tides get all the hype.
